On April 15, the Supreme People's Procuratorate, the All China Federation of Trade Unions and the All China Women's Federation jointly released a typical case of protecting the rights and interests of women and children. Among them, the case of forced indecency of Zhou, handled by the People's Procuratorate of Jinghu District, Wuhu City, Anhui Province, was selected. Today, the Procuratorial Daily reported the case.

The crime

Encountered indecency in the process of seeking employment

In July 2023, Ms. Hong, who went to Zhou's company to apply for a job, was taken by Zhou to a hospital to contact business after a preliminary interview. At about 17:00 on the same day, Mr. Zhou asked Ms. Hong to drive him to a hotel to check in, and claimed that there was still business need to continue negotiations, so that Ms. Hong followed him into the room.

However, just when Ms. Hong thought that the business negotiation was over and she was ready to leave, Zhou suddenly hugged her and asked to have sex with her. After being rejected, Zhou threatened to know her home address and family situation, spread rumors about her lifestyle problems, and threatened to have a certain influence in the circle. If Ms. Hong did not comply, she would be difficult to gain a foothold in the industry in the future. After a series of threats and threats, Mr. Zhou committed indecent acts against Ms. Hong.

Later, Ms. Hong fought back tears and left the hotel, telling her boyfriend what had happened. Accompanied by her boyfriend, Ms. Hong reported the case to the public security organ.

After the investigation, the public security organ found that there was no other evidence to support Zhou's indecent behavior, except Ms. Hong's statement and her boyfriend's testimony. Zhou has also refused to plead guilty, arguing that Ms. Hong volunteered to open a room with her in the hotel in order to obtain a higher position and salary. To this end, the People's Procuratorate of Jinghu District, Wuhu City, Anhui Province was invited to intervene and guide the public security organs to investigate and collect evidence.

evidence

Investigate and verify the authenticity of the victim's statement

The evidence on record is weak, and Mr. Zhou insisted that it was both parties' will. Is there any possibility of Ms. Hong's false accusation and frame up in this case? The prosecutor suggested that the public security organ take the surveillance video and check-in registration materials of the hotel and ask the hotel staff.

"Through the monitoring video of the hotel lobby and elevator, we found that after Ms. Hong followed Mr. Zhou into the elevator, they always kept a proper social distance, and Ms. Hong put her hands behind her back and behaved appropriately. Until entering the hotel room, neither of them had any close communication or physical movements. According to common sense, this is not consistent with what Zhou said, 'Ms. Hong volunteered to open a room with her'. " Chen Yue, the case undertaker and the prosecutor of the First Procuratorate of Jinghu District Procuratorate, told the reporter.

However, just overthrowing Zhou's excuse is not enough to determine the authenticity of Ms. Hong's statement. When analyzing the surveillance video frame by frame, Ms. Hong's aggrieved facial expression after leaving the room attracted Chen Yue's attention. "According to Ms. Hong's statement, she wanted to cry after leaving the room, but she held back because she wanted to leave as soon as possible. Ms. Hong's aggrieved facial expression just confirms this statement." Chen Yue further explained, "This monitoring reflects Ms. Hong's psychological state of fear and injustice after being forced to molest."

At the same time, the case prosecutor also found that on the way home, Ms. Hong was crying while driving. This also further strengthened Chen Yue's inner conviction: "If it is a false accusation, the victim cannot always disguise on the way home. Moreover, she cannot predict that we will call for road monitoring, so she can judge that the victim's statement is true."

conviction

Such verbal threats should be identified as "coercion"

In the interview, Chen Yue told reporters: "After the case was transferred for review and prosecution, after a comprehensive review, we believe that Mr. Zhou used his position advantages, psychological advantages and environmental advantages in the process of recruiting female workers to coerce Ms. Hong verbally. This behavior has formed a psychological forcing effect on Ms. Hong, to the extent that she dare not resist, and should be recognized as' coercion 'in the crime of forced indecency according to law."

When making the judgment that Zhou's behavior has a psychological compulsion on Ms. Hong, Chen Yue, in combination with her inquiry and investigation process, added: "We also found that her character is timid and timid. Combining her mental state and psychological state after the event, we can infer that Ms. Hong did not dare to make timely and effective resistance when she was subjected to Zhou's verbal threats and indecent acts.

On November 6, 2023, the Jinghu District Procuratorate filed a public prosecution against Zhou on suspicion of compulsory indecency. At the same time, the case prosecutor also continued to explain and reason about Zhou. In the end, Mr. Zhou expressed his willingness to plead guilty and accept punishment, apologized to the victim, and volunteered to pay 40000 yuan for the mental loss, in order to get Ms. Hong's understanding.

In the end, the court adopted the sentencing proposal put forward by the procuratorial organ and sentenced Zhou to six months' imprisonment for the crime of forced indecency. After the judgment came into effect, Jinghu District Procuratorate also took the initiative to provide psychological guidance and assistance to Ms. Hong.
